Transfixed By the Dahlia, starring Emily Marsh, will be playing at Theatre Row Studios 410 W 42nd St, New York, NY 10036 tonight, Sept 20th at 7:30 pm.

Elizabeth Short was immortalized as a femme fatale but where did she come from? How did she end up as one of the most infamous and sensationalized murder victims of all time? Transfixed by the Dahlia flows effortlessly between interviews, movement, song, and ritual poetic drama as Emily Marsh, a 22-year-old girl from 2014, holds up her life to Elizabeth Shorts'. Unearthed is the dangerous nature of isolation, and the strength of community.

2014 United Solo, the world's largest solo theatre festival, celebrates its 5th anniversary season and its dynamic expansion in scope and popularity. Over 130 shows from six continents are staged at Theatre Row: 410 West 42nd Street, New York City.
